## Canary Deploy Gating — Build Provenance

Every canary promotion in the Larkspur pipeline must carry verified provenance before traffic exceeds 5%. Support staff should confirm that the attestation was signed by the Quillgate builder and that the source ref matches the release branch. If error rates breach 0.5% during the hold window, the gate auto-reverts and provenance is re-checked on retry. Never approve a manual override without a verified attestation. For escalations, quote the provenance record below.

pipeline stamp: htk3_69f

Q: How do I unlock the wellness room for a booked slot? A: Check the Fenwick facilities diary for the booking, confirm the requester's name, then escort them to Room 2.14. The door has a standalone keypad, not a badge reader. Enter the current code, listed below.

turnstile pass: bdg-NG-3

## Pickwise 4.2 — default changes

The pick-list optimizer now batches by zone instead of by order age. Route scoring defaults to shortest-walk; the legacy FIFO mode is opt-in. Congestion penalties are enabled out of the box. New hires: check staging before assuming old behavior. The optimizer now ships with these defaults.

settings of fajog-kajof:
julwyn:
  pin: 0480
  tenant: rusok
  seal: seal_456f5567
  metrics_host: metrics.julwyn.qirvangrid.local
  standby_team: rusath
  escalation: eliael-jorax
  nonce: ca9746